Owner & President, Built-Mor Buildings
Built-Mor Buildings is a premier post-frame construction company serving Southern Illinois since 1983.
With over 40 years of experience in finance, management, and community leadership, Rick brings a wealth of expertise to his role.
Career Highlights
- Built-Mor Buildings (Owner & President): Leads company specializing in high-quality, cost-effective post-frame structures.
- Knapp Oil Co, Inc (1985-2020): Managed all aspects of business including finance, construction, and asset management.
- Elliot State Bank (1980-1984): Served as Controller, reporting to the Board of Directors.
- Pepsi Mid-America (1978-1980): Designed and implemented the company’s first Internal Audit Program.
Education & Certification
- MBA, Southern Illinois University
- BA in Business Administration, Graceland College
- Certified Public Accountant, University of Illinois
Past Community Service
- Past leadership roles in Illinois Fuel & Retail Association and Illinois Truck Stop Association
- 16-year Board Member and President of Flora, Illinois Unit 35 School Board
- Active in community service: Pastor, Youth Leader, and Treasurer at Brush Creek Campground
